About the Role
As an HR Partner, you will provide expert advice and guidance on a broad range of HR matters, supporting managers and employees across the employee lifecycle. Working closely with the HR Manager and wider HR team, you will play a key role in ensuring our HR policies and practices are applied consistently, fairly and in line with employment legislation and best practice.
A significant part of this role involves supporting and managing employee relations casework. We are particularly interested in hearing from candidates who already have experience handling matters such as absence management, disciplinary issues, grievances, capability and organisational change. However, we would also welcome applications from HR professionals with a solid generalist background who have a genuine interest in developing their employee relations expertise.
What You'll Be Doing
- Partnering with managers to provide practical HR advice and people solutions.
- Managing and supporting a varied employee relations caseload.
- Coaching managers through formal and informal HR processes.
- Supporting organisational change, absence management, performance management and wellbeing initiatives.
- Contributing to the review and development of HR policies and procedures.
- Supporting recruitment and selection activities across the College.
- Participating in HR projects and people-related initiatives that support the College's People Strategy.
- Delivering a professional, customer-focused HR service that aligns with the College's values.
About You
We are looking for someone who:
- Is CIPD qualified (or working towards qualification) and educated to SCQF Level 8 or equivalent experience.
- Has a sound understanding of employment legislation and HR best practice.
- Has experience providing HR advice and guidance to managers.
- Has employee relations experience or a strong interest in developing expertise in this area.
- Can build credible relationships and influence positive outcomes.
- Possesses excellent communication, coaching and problem-solving skills.
- Is organised, resilient and able to manage a varied workload.
- Shares our commitment to equality, diversity, inclusion and delivering an excellent service.
- Experience working within a unionised environment or the education sector would be advantageous, but is not essential.
